Default whats your weight

iv been trying to loose some weight on my04 sti, better power to weight = faster and better handling was the theory so lost the spair (wheel ofcourse), and got some lighter weight team dynamics pro race 1.2's, d1 wheels nuts, oddysey lightweight battery pc680, and usual exhaust mods getting rid of heavy cats etc,
went down the scrap yard with a mate and they were nice enuf to weigh my car for me on the weight bridge, came in at 1380kg think the standard weight is 1470kg so well happy
any one else had there car weighed? any other ideas how i could loose some more weight without getting to drastic
